It seems my hunch about lower income ZIP codes and percentages of Medicare payments doled out in the past in the geographical areas were spot on. These are factors in the formula, age, sex, welfare status, and institutional status The areas were initially MSA's or metro areas over 50K population. Then the counties of states but Los Angeles is in one county and Atlanta is in eighteen counties so that didn't work. They had to find a smaller area for the Part C plans to pay off. Zip codes.
